Casmyn, Nkayi United win as ZPC (Hwange) are held

Lovemore Dube, [email protected]

Casmyn and Nkayi United continued their fight for respectable finishes in the Zifa Southern Region League as they won their respective matches on Sunday.

Log leaders ZPC (Hwange) were held by Zebra Revolution to a nil all draw.

Nkayi beat Ajax Hotspurs 3-0 in a match played at the White City B Arena on Sunday.

Tinotenda Chitete one of the leading goalscorers in the league was on target alongside Future Gumbo and Prince Chitova in the big win.

Chitete is now tied with Hwange’s Justin Kaunda at 12 goals and Casmyn’s Tatenda Ushe.

Nkayi are eager to end the season on a high in their inaugural season despite trailing leaders ZPC Hwange by 17 points.

With the win Nkayi took their points’ tally to 35 points from 20 matches and with their 31 goals they have the third most potent strikeforce in the league. Leaders ZPC (Hwange) with 38 goals for and Mkhokheli Dube’s Zebra Revolution has 33.

ZPC (Hwange) received a big scare when being held to a 0-0 draw by Zebra Revolution a young side of boys out to have fun on the field and express themselves in the game and market their promising talents.

With the gained point ZPC (Hwange) took their points’ tally to 52 and now need just 17 points to seal the title and prepare for the 2024 Premiership season.

Revolution remained glued on seventh position with 28 points. For a young team making its debut with meagre resources, the youngsters who made history by becoming the first team using Sizinda grounds to be promoted into the Zifa Southern Region League.

Second placed Casmyn were on top of their game when they beat visiting Bulawayo City at Turk Mine on Sunday.

Ushe who is having a good season and is among the top goalscorers scored one of the two goals for the goal miners with Wilfred Nzondo netting the other.

Nzondo has scored six goals for his team.

Casmyn stayed second with 39 points, 13 adrift of log leaders ZPC (Hwange) who took their unbeaten run to 20 matches with 10 to go before the season ends.

Results at a glance
Zim Saints FC 1-1 Vic Falls City FC, Zebra Revolution 0-0 ZPC Hwange, Nkayi Utd 3-0 Ajax Hotspurs, Adachi FC 0-0 Bosso 90 FC, Casmyn FC 2-0 Bulawayo City FC, Talen Vision FC 0-0 Mainline FC, DRC Utd 0-0 Jordan FC
